The Art of Culinary Fusion: Vancouver's Cantina Social Club

In the heart of downtown Vancouver, a culinary adventure awaits, blending the vibrant energy of Mexico City's cantinas with the freshest seasonal ingredients from British Columbia. Cantina Social Club is not just a pop-up restaurant; it's a celebration of cultural fusion and culinary creativity.

A Michelin-Starred Team's Vision

The team behind this unique concept is no stranger to culinary excellence. With a Michelin Bib Gourmand recognition under their belt for Chupito Cocteleria, they're bringing their expertise to a new level. What's particularly intriguing is their approach to fusion cuisine. Instead of a static menu, they embrace the ever-changing nature of seasonal ingredients, allowing the menu to evolve and surprise guests with each visit.

Seasonal Ingredients, Endless Possibilities

Chef Maria Ponce takes the lead in the kitchen, drawing inspiration from Mexico's diverse regions. The menu isn't set in stone; it's a living, breathing entity that adapts to the availability of local produce. This approach not only ensures the freshest flavors but also adds an element of excitement and discovery for diners. Personally, I find this commitment to seasonality refreshing, as it challenges the notion of a fixed menu and encourages a more sustainable and creative culinary practice.

Cocktails and Culture

The beverage program is equally impressive, with a focus on agave spirits and creative cocktails. Bartenders Tara Davies and Erick Vazquez, known for their innovative concoctions at Chupito, bring their expertise to the table. The drinks menu features seasonal cocktails, local wines, and classic Mexican beverages, all designed to enhance the dining experience. This attention to detail in beverage pairing is often overlooked but is crucial to creating a well-rounded culinary journey.

Communal Dining and Cultural Exchange

Cantina Social Club goes beyond food and drinks; it's a cultural experience. The pop-up embraces the communal and lively atmosphere of traditional Mexican cantinas. Communal seating encourages interaction and a sense of community, fostering a unique dining environment. This aspect is often missing in many modern restaurants, where individual tables dominate. By bringing people together, the pop-up creates an opportunity for cultural exchange and a more immersive dining experience.

A Dancing Skeleton's Tale

The mascot, Sergio El Bailador, adds a playful twist to the concept. Inspired by Mexican folk art, this dancing skeleton reflects the festive spirit of cantinas while paying homage to the culture.
